summaryrefslogtreecommitdiff
path: root/docutils/parsers/rst/directives/admonitions.py
diff options
context:
space:
mode:
Diffstat (limited to 'docutils/parsers/rst/directives/admonitions.py')
-rw-r--r--docutils/parsers/rst/directives/admonitions.py2
1 files changed, 2 insertions, 0 deletions
diff --git a/docutils/parsers/rst/directives/admonitions.py b/docutils/parsers/rst/directives/admonitions.py
index b5b60811e..1e893a0af 100644
--- a/docutils/parsers/rst/directives/admonitions.py
+++ b/docutils/parsers/rst/directives/admonitions.py
@@ -30,6 +30,8 @@ class BaseAdmonition(Directive):
self.assert_has_content()
text = '\n'.join(self.content)
admonition_node = self.node_class(text, **self.options)
+ admonition_node.source, admonition_node.line = (
+ self.state_machine.get_source_and_line(self.lineno))
self.add_name(admonition_node)
if self.node_class is nodes.admonition:
title_text = self.arguments[0]